View MoreElectric corded circular saws are versatile tools used in woodworking and construction for cutting various materials. However, like any mechanical device, they can develop faults over time. Here are some common issues to watch out for:
Blade Dullness: Overuse or cutting through hard materials can dull the blade, leading to inefficient cutting and potential safety hazards. Regular blade maintenance and replacement are essential.
Motor Problems: Motors can overheat or burn out if the Electric Corded Circular Saw is overloaded or used continuously without breaks. This may result in reduced power or complete failure. Allow the motor to cool down and avoid overexertion.
Inaccurate Cuts: Misalignment of the blade or fence can cause inaccurate cuts. This issue may stem from loose components or improper adjustments. Ensure that all parts are properly secured and calibrated.
Excessive Vibration: Vibrations can indicate issues with the Electric Corded Circular Saw's bearings, blade, or other internal components. Excessive vibration can affect the quality of cuts and lead to user discomfort. Inspect and maintain these parts regularly.
Trigger and Switch Problems: Faulty triggers or switches can lead to difficulty in starting or stopping the saw. Ensure that these components are clean, well-maintained, and functioning correctly.
Cord Damage: The power cord is susceptible to wear and tear, including fraying or cuts. Damaged cords can be a safety hazard and should be replaced promptly.
Safety Features Malfunction: Electric Corded Circular saws are equipped with safety features like blade guards and safety switches. If these features fail to operate correctly, it can pose significant risks. Regularly inspect and test these safety mechanisms.
Dust and Debris Buildup: Sawdust and debris can accumulate inside the saw, affecting its performance. Regularly clean the saw's interior to prevent clogs and overheating.
Lack of Lubrication: Bearings and moving parts require proper lubrication to function smoothly. Neglecting this maintenance can lead to premature wear and tear.
Electrical Issues: Faulty wiring, loose connections, or damaged components in the electrical system can result in power fluctuations or intermittent operation. These issues should be addressed by a qualified technician.
To ensure the safe and efficient operation of an electric corded circular saw, regular maintenance, proper usage, and adherence to safety guidelines are crucial. When encountering any of these faults, it's advisable to consult the manufacturer's manual for troubleshooting steps or seek professional repair services when necessary.
Circular Power Saw Electric Tools, whether corded or cordless, are indispensable tools in the construction and woodworking industries. These tools are composed of various components that work in harmony to facilitate precise cutting. Here's a breakdown of the key components:
Housing: The housing, often made of durable plastic or metal, encases the internal components of the saw, providing protection and stability.
Motor: At the heart of the Circular Power Saw Electric Tools is an electric motor. This motor powers the blade and is available in different power ratings, depending on the saw's intended use.
Blade: Circular Power Saw Electric Tools feature a circular, toothed blade that rotates rapidly to cut through materials. Blades come in various sizes and types designed for cutting specific materials, such as wood, metal, or masonry.
Blade Guard: The blade guard is a safety feature that covers the blade when it's not in use and automatically retracts during cutting to expose only a portion of the blade necessary for the cut.
Base Plate or Shoe: This flat, metal, or plastic plate rests on the work surface and provides stability and guidance for the saw during cutting. It often has markings for measuring and aligning cuts.
Depth Adjustment: Circular Power Saw Electric Tools have a depth adjustment mechanism that allows users to set the cutting depth to suit the material they are working with.
Bevel Adjustment: Many Circular Power Saw Electric Tools can be tilted to make bevel cuts at various angles. A bevel adjustment mechanism allows users to set the desired angle.
Handle and Trigger: The handle provides a comfortable grip for the user, and the trigger is used to start and stop the saw. Safety switches are often integrated into the handle to prevent accidental activation.
Dust Port: To minimize dust and debris, Circular Power Saw Electric Tools may include a dust port for attaching a vacuum or dust collection system.
Safety Features: These include blade guards, blade brakes, and electric brakes to enhance user safety during operation.
Power Cord: In Circular Power Saw Electric Tools, a power cord supplies electricity to the motor.
Battery Compartment (Cordless Models): Cordless circular saws contain a rechargeable battery pack that powers the motor. These models also include a battery compartment and charging port.
